Recognizing SMILE Eye Surgery



When taking into consideration SMILE Eye Surgery, it's important to comprehend the procedure and its benefits. SMILE, which means Small Laceration Lenticule Extraction, is a minimally intrusive laser eye surgery that fixes typical vision troubles like nearsightedness (nearsightedness).

During the procedure, your eye specialist will certainly use a femtosecond laser to develop a little cut in your cornea. Through this incision, a small disc of tissue called a lenticule is removed, improving the cornea and correcting your vision.

One of the essential benefits of SMILE Eye Surgery is its fast recovery time. Many individuals experience improved vision within a day or more after the treatment, with minimal discomfort.

In addition, SMILE is understood for its high success price in providing lasting vision improvement. Unlike LASIK, SMILE doesn't call for the development of a flap in the cornea, lowering the danger of problems and permitting an extra stable corneal framework post-surgery.

Establishing Eligibility for SMILE



To figure out if you're qualified for SMILE eye surgical treatment, your eye doctor will conduct an extensive analysis of your eye wellness and vision needs. Throughout this examination, variables such as the security of your vision prescription, the density of your cornea, and the total health and wellness of your eyes will be assessed.

Normally, candidates for SMILE more than 22 years old, have a stable vision prescription for a minimum of a year, and have healthy corneas without conditions like keratoconus.




Your eye doctor will likewise consider your total eye wellness, any existing eye conditions, and your way of living requires to determine if SMILE is the appropriate option for you.
